From 00ea324d48f7305bd5c96ccb4477e11607d3d85a Mon Sep 17 00:00:00 2001 From: dukantic Date: Tue, 8 Jul 2025 21:39:21 +0000 Subject: [PATCH] Delete .gitlab-ci.yml --- .gitlab-ci.yml | 66 -------------------------------------------------- 1 file changed, 66 deletions(-) delete mode 100644 .gitlab-ci.yml di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ml deleted file mode 100644 index e62767b..0000000 --- a/.gitlab-ci.yml +++ /dev/null @@ -1,66 +0,0 @@ -stages: - - build - - release - -build-linux: - stage: build - image: rust:latest - script: - - rustup default stable - - cargo build --release - - mkdir -p build/linux - - cp target/release/polymusic build/linux/polymusic - - cp -r assets build/linux/assets - - cd build && zip -r linux-build.zip linux - artifacts: - paths: - - build/linux - - build/linux-build.zip - expire_in: 1 week - rules: - - if: '$CI_COMMIT_TAG' - when: always - - when: never - -build-windows: - stage: build - image: rust:latest - before_script: - - apt update && apt install -y mingw-w64 zip - script: - - rustup default stable - - rustup target add x86_64-pc-windows-gnu - - cargo build --release --target x86_64-pc-windows-gnu - - mkdir -p build/windows - - cp target/x86_64-pc-windows-gnu/release/polymusic.exe build/windows/polymusic.exe - - cp -r assets build/windows/assets - - cd build && zip -r windows-build.zip windows - artifacts: - paths: - - build/windows - - build/windows-build.zip - expire_in: 1 week - rules: - - if: '$CI_COMMIT_TAG' - when: always - - when: never - -release: - stage: release - image: curlimages/curl:latest - script: - - echo "Attaching builds to GitLab Release..." - release: - tag_name: "$CI_COMMIT_TAG" - name: "$CI_COMMIT_TAG" - description: "Release $CI_COMMIT_TAG" - assets: - links: - - name: "Linux Build (.zip)" - url: "$CI_PROJECT_URL/-/jobs/$CI_JOB_ID/artifacts/file/build/linux-build.zip" - - name: "Windows Build (.zip)" - url: "$CI_PROJECT_URL/-/jobs/$CI_JOB_ID/artifacts/file/build/windows-build.zip" - rules: - - if: '$CI_COMMIT_TAG' - when: always - - when: never